Next flood warning system
The Environment Agency (EA) is an executive non-departmental public body sponsored by Defra, the UK government department which is responsible for improving and protecting the environment.
The EA works to create better places for people and wildlife, and support sustainable development.
The EA are also responsible for managing the risk of flooding from main rivers, reservoirs, estuaries and the sea.
The EA has used a flood warning system (FWS) to deliver a flood warning service to the public, partners and the media for over twenty years.
At the core of FWS is the message dissemination system used by the EA to send warnings of flooding by text, email and telephone.
It enables the EA to fulfil its statutory duty (under the Civil Contingencies Act as a Category 1 responder) to warn the public and EAs partner organisations of risk to life and property because of flooding or the threat of flooding.
The purpose of this notice is for the EA to make known its intention of a planned procurement and to commence the market engagement process (in advance of commencing any formal procurement process) for the next flood warning system.
